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,321,664,541
Lastest Block:
1,957,247
Utxos:
1,983,353
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
07/06/2021 23:44:32 UTC
Txid
db872563124c308a64c4b94fbdbf95babe8d25577687de539f4fe0835f3dcae1
Block
176,343
Block hash
73286f192d4f77f19785db40554008f64e678d503c1484dee5507c4fb4409840
Stake amount
93.9200589 XEP
Sender
PKiXT6JEamaR3VcMBeow6cAHjNUGfaAGRe
Recipient
PKiXT6JEamaR3VcMBeow6cAHjNUGfaAGRe
(1,006,228.38183316 XEP)